National Institute of Mental Health - The largest scientific organization in the world dedicated to research focused
on the understanding, treatment, and prevention of mental disorders and the promotion of mental health.
National Alliance on Mental Illness - The nation's largest grassroots mental health organization dedicated to building
better lives for the millions of Americans affected by mental illness. NAMI advocates for access to services, treatment, supports
and research and is steadfast in its commitment to raise awareness and build a community for hope for all of those in need.
Substance Abuse & Mental Health Services Administration - The agency within the U.S. Department of Health and Human Services that leads
public health efforts to advance the behavioral health of the nation. SAMHSA's mission is to reduce the impact of substance
abuse and mental illness on America's communities.
Celebrate Recovery - A biblical and balanced program that helps us overcome our hurts, hang-ups, and habits. It is based on
the actual words of Jesus rather than psychological theory. 20 years ago, Saddleback Church launched Celebrate Recovery with
43 people. It was designed as a program to help those struggling with hurts, habits and hang-ups by showing them the loving
power of Jesus Christ through a recovery process.
